TP官方网址下载_tpwallet官网下载安卓版/最新版/苹果版钱包-tp官方下载安卓最新版本2024

TPWallet钱包如何连接BABI:稳定币支付的高效实践与全链路技术分析

(说明:以下内容以“连接并使用BABI生态”为目标展开,具体链上名称/网络参数可能因BABI实际部署(主网/测试网)不同而变化。建议在操作前确认:BABI合约地址、RPC/链ID、代币合约与是否需白名单。)

一、TPWallet钱包连接BABI的总体流程

1)准备条件

- 确认TPWallet版本与权限:确保钱包应用已更新,且已开启必要权限(例如网络/浏览器唤起)。

- 获取BABI接入信息:通常包括链ID(Chain ID)、RPC节点、浏览器/区块浏览器域名(可选)、稳定币/路由器合约地址(取决于集成方式)。

2)在TPWahttps://www.gajjzd.com ,llet中添加/切换到BABI网络

- 方法A:若TPWallet内置BABI网络,可直接在“网络/链管理”中选择。

- 方法B:若需手动添加网络:在“添加自定义网络”中填写RPC地址、链ID、货币符号与区块浏览器链接(按BABI文档填写)。

- 完成后进行一次基础校验:进入“资产/交易”页面,查看是否能正常拉取余额与交易状态。

3)连接到BABI相关DApp/聚合器(如需要)

- 在支持Web3连接的页面里选择“TPWallet连接”。

- 若出现“拒绝/失败”,通常是链不匹配或钱包网络未切到BABI:先切网,再重试。

- 对于需要签名的操作(例如授权ERC20、加入流动性、发起交换/支付),务必逐项核对:

- 合约地址是否为BABI官方或已审计的合约

- 交易路由与滑点(slippage)设置

- 授权额度(尽量选择“最小必要额度”,避免无限授权)

二、全方位分析:高效支付技术(High-Efficiency Payment)

1)链上支付的关键瓶颈

- 交易确认延迟:区块出块时间与打包策略影响体验。

- Gas波动:费用变化会导致成本不可控。

- 路由效率:跨池/跨路由交换越多,失败率与滑点风险越高。

2)高效支付的实现策略

- 交易批处理(Batching):将多步骤(如授权+交换)尽可能合并或使用支持多步骤的路由合约/聚合器。

- 预估与动态参数:在发起前读取链上状态(余额、储备、价格影响),动态计算滑点与最小可得数量(minOut)。

- 选择高流动性路径:优先选择深度更大的交易池或更可靠的路由。

- 费用策略:根据网络拥堵情况调整Gas或采用自动估价逻辑(由DApp/聚合器承担则更稳定)。

3)与“BABI”场景的对应要点

- 若BABI提供支付入口合约或路由器:尽量使用其官方路由器进行“稳定币->收款方/商户”的标准化流程,减少集成差异。

- 若BABI用于跨链或聚合:注意跨链消息确认时间与失败回滚机制(通常会影响“支付即到账”的承诺)。

三、数字支付技术发展趋势(趋势与落地建议)

1)从“链上转账”到“支付基础设施”

- 越来越多项目把链上转账抽象成支付服务:统一支付单、统一回执、统一风控。

- 商户侧更强调“可追踪、可对账、可审计”。

2)账户抽象与体验优化

- 未来更多钱包将采用账户抽象(Account Abstraction)让用户免签名复杂度、降低失败率。

- 对开发与运营更友好:可统一失败重试、统一日志与告警。

3)稳定币与低波动支付

- 稳定币将成为数字支付的主流计价与结算资产。

- 趋势是:稳定币支付更“流程化”,并与风控、限额、黑名单/合规模块结合。

4)更强的可观测性(Observability)

- 从“能用”到“可监控”:日志、链上事件、告警、审计轨迹成为基础能力。

四、便捷市场处理(Merchant/交易市场处理)

1)商户侧常见诉求

- 快速接入:希望用同一套接口/流程支持多链与多币种。

- 对账与回执:能生成支付凭证、查询订单状态。

- 风控与限额:避免异常转账或欺诈。

2)用户侧体验点

- 明确展示:收款方地址、金额、稳定币类型、预计到账时间、网络费用。

- 一键重试:失败时提供原因(网络不匹配、滑点过大、授权不足等)。

3)在TPWallet+(BABI)集成中的建议

- 使用标准化的“支付单/订单”流程:由DApp生成订单并在链上记录关键字段(订单号、金额、币种、商户回调/状态)。

- 若涉及多币种路由,确保每种稳定币的最小精度、合约地址一致。

五、弹性云计算系统(Elastic Cloud System)用于支付后端

1)为什么需要弹性

- 支付请求可能出现突发峰值:活动营销、链上拥堵、自然流量波动。

- 弹性伸缩能让系统在高峰保持稳定,并在低谷降低成本。

2)推荐架构思路(概念级)

- 网关层:接收支付请求、校验参数、限流。

- 状态服务:维护订单状态机(创建->等待链上确认->完成/失败)。

- 链上监听:订阅区块/事件(WebSocket或轮询),更新订单回执。

- 缓存与队列:缓存价格/路由信息,使用队列处理链上回调与重试。

- 告警与追踪:集中式日志与链路追踪,方便定位失败原因。

3)弹性伸缩与稳定性策略

- HPA/Auto Scaling:根据CPU、队列长度、请求耗时触发扩容。

- 降级策略:拥堵时限制路由复杂度或改用更可靠路径。

- 幂等设计:回调/事件可能重复,必须以订单号或事件hash做幂等更新。

六、创新支付方案(Innovation Payment Solutions)

1)“稳定币支付+链上回执”的组合

- 方案核心:用稳定币完成结算,同时把回执写入链上事件或订单合约,提升可对账性。

2)路由智能化

- 对接聚合器/路由器:根据流动性与手续费动态选择最优路径。

- 失败自动重试:在合理窗口内对滑点/路由进行微调。

3)支付与合规风控联动(可选)

- 交易限额、风险地址识别、异常频率检测。

- 只有通过风控后才允许执行授权/交换/打款。

七、日志查看(Logs):如何定位“连接/支付失败”

1)需要看哪些日志类型

- 钱包侧:连接DApp失败、签名失败、网络切换失败的提示(通常在TPWallet或DApp弹窗中可见)。

- DApp侧:请求参数、链ID检测、合约调用结果、交易hash。

- 链上侧:交易回执、事件日志(events)、失败原因码(revert reason)或gas消耗异常。

2)实操定位路径

- 第一步:确认网络是否为BABI(链ID一致)。

- 第二步:复制交易hash,进入BABI区块浏览器查询:

- 交易是否成功(Status/Success)

- 是否发生revert,并查看可能的原因

- 相关合约地址是否正确

- 第三步:检查授权与余额

- token approve是否到位

- 余额是否足够覆盖 amount + 可能的费用

- 第四步:检查滑点与最小可得(minOut)

- 如果失败多发生在交换/路由阶段,优先排查滑点过小。

3)对开发者/运营的建议

- 在后端记录:订单号<->交易hash<->用户地址<->路由参数的映射。

- 做告警:例如“同一错误码在5分钟内激增”“某稳定币池流动性不足”等。

八、稳定币(Stablecoins):在BABI支付中的要点

1)选择稳定币的原则

- 可靠性:优先选择主流稳定币合约或BABI生态指定的稳定币。

- 流动性:确保在BABI上有足够深度,减少滑点。

- 精度与最小单位:确认decimals(如6或18),避免金额换算错误。

2)稳定币支付流程的常见坑

- 无限授权风险:授权过大一旦合约存在问题可能造成资产损失;尽量最小授权。

- 价格偏差:稳定币虽低波动,但在兑换为其他资产或跨池时仍可能受流动性与路由影响。

- 小额交易失败:若合约对最小金额有要求,需预估滑点与最小可得。

3)建议的稳定币操作清单

- 先在BABI上确认稳定币余额。

- 执行最小授权(或使用permit机制如DApp支持)。

- 发起支付/交换时设置合理滑点,并展示预计回执。

- 交易完成后以区块事件或订单状态确认到账。

九、将全流程落到可执行的“检查表”

- 网络:TPWallet已切换到BABI(链ID/RPC正确)。

- 钱包授权:稳定币approve已完成且额度合理。

- 参数:收款方、金额、币种合约地址正确。

- 路由:选择流动性较深路径;滑点设置合理。

- 成功判定:通过交易hash回执+订单状态机确认。

- 日志:记录并可复盘每次失败的错误码、revert原因与路由参数。

- 基础设施:后端弹性伸缩、队列幂等、链上监听稳定。

十、结语:以稳定币为中心的高效支付闭环

连接TPWallet并完成BABI支付,本质上是“网络匹配+授权准确+路由高效+可观测性完善”的闭环。通过高效支付策略、弹性云计算后端、完善日志查看与稳定币精度/流动性管理,你可以更稳、更快地实现全流程支付体验。

作者:林岚岚 发布时间:2026-04-19 18:00:27

相关阅读